PHYS 135 - OpticsSemester Hours: 3 Every Other Year
Propagation of light as an electromagnetic wave, its vectorial nature, relativistic optics, coherence and interference. Fresnel and Fraunhofer diffraction, the optics of solids, lasers and holography.
Prerequisite(s)/Course Notes: PHYS 012A and 012B .
